Accurate rotor dynamics analysis depends on precise eddy-current probe scaling; this unit is calibrated for a linear output of 7.87 V per mm (200 mV\/mil). During installation, technicians must perform gap voltage validation to ensure the probe tip operates at the -10 VDC target midpoint within the 0.25 mm to 2.3 mm linear range. Internal shielding ensures cross-talk suppression in multi-probe installations, preventing signal interference between adjacent sensors monitoring the same shaft cross-section.\u003c\/p\u003e\n\u003ch3\u003eOrdering Info\u003c\/h3\u003e\n\u003cul class=\"list-paddingleft-2\"\u003e\n\u003cli\u003e\n\u003cp\u003e1 x 330106-05-30-10-02-CN Proximity Probe\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003e2 x Brass Jam Nuts (For probe mounting)\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003e1 x Technical Installation Guide\u003c\/p\u003e\n\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ch3\u003eInstallation Guidelines\u003c\/h3\u003e\n\u003cul class=\"list-paddingleft-2\"\u003e\n\u003cli\u003e\n\u003cp\u003eMounting Clearance: Maintain a minimum radial clearance of 10 mm from surrounding metal to prevent false displacement readings caused by side-view effects.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eTorque Limits: Use a torque wrench on the provided jam nuts; do not exceed 5.6 Nm to avoid casing deformation.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eCable Routing: Ensure coaxial cables are secured with ties to prevent mechanical fatigue; avoid sharp bends (minimum 25 mm radius) near the connector interface.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eGrounding: The probe casing is electrically common to the machinery housing; ensure the mounting bracket is properly bonded to the machine frame.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ch3\u003eFrequently Asked Questions\u003c\/h3\u003e\n\u003cul class=\"list-paddingleft-2\"\u003e\n\u003cli\u003e\n\u003cp\u003eIs the probe tip sensitive to temperature fluctuations?\u003c\/p\u003e\n\u003cp\u003eThe PPS tip is engineered for high stability. However, extreme thermal gradients can cause minor scale factor shifts, which should be accounted for in the system calibration.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eCan I replace the cable if it becomes damaged?\u003c\/p\u003e\n\u003cp\u003eNo. The 330106 is a sealed assembly. Damage to the cable or the integral connector requires the replacement of the entire probe unit to maintain impedance integrity.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eHow is gap voltage verified during setup?\u003c\/p\u003e\n\u003cp\u003eConnect the probe to its designated Proximitor, then measure the DC voltage at the monitor output while adjusting the gap with a precision feeler gauge or micrometer.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eDoes the probe require a specific proximity sensor type?\u003c\/p\u003e\n\u003cp\u003eYes. It must be paired with a compatible 3300 XL Proximitor sensor calibrated for 8 mm probe impedance to ensure the specified 200 mV\/mil output.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eCan this probe be installed in an explosive atmosphere?\u003c\/p\u003e\n\u003cp\u003eYes, provided the installation adheres to the system's intrinsic safety (Ex i) control drawing requirements for hazardous area classifications.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eWhat is the maximum output cable length?\u003c\/p\u003e\n\u003cp\u003eThe total system length (Probe + Extension Cable) must be 5 or 9 meters to remain within the calibrated impedance range of the Proximitor.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eIs the connector waterproof?\u003c\/p\u003e\n\u003cp\u003eThe ClickLoc connector is oil-resistant and dust-tight, but it is not rated for total water submersion or high-pressure spray cleaning.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003cli\u003e\n\u003cp\u003eHow do I detect a probe failure?\u003c\/p\u003e\n\u003cp\u003eMonitor the DC gap voltage. A sudden shift to the negative or positive supply rail typically indicates an open or short circuit in the probe coil or cable.\u003c\/p\u003e\n\u003c\/li\u003e\n\u003c\/ul\u003e","brand":"Bently Nevada","offers":[{"title":"Default Title","offer_id":45518809563309,"sku":"330106-05-30-10-02-CN","price":99.0,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0733\/1613\/9181\/files\/bently-nevada-330106-05-30-10-02-cn-proximity-transducer-xafhx44fuaf.jpg?v=1766979431","url":"https:\/\/www.maxwellplc.com\/ga\/products\/bently-nevada-330106-05-30-10-02-cn-3300-xl-proximity-probe","provider":"Maxwell PLC Ltd","version":"1.0","type":"link"}
